Verb

edit

اِشْتَغَلَ (ištaḡala) VIII, non-past يَشْتَغِلُ‎ (yaštaḡilu)

  1. to occupy oneself, to busy oneself
  2. to be occupied, to be busy
  3. to be engaged
  4. to attend, to devote oneself
  5. to work, to study
  6. to operate

South Levantine Arabic

edit
Root
ش غ ل
7 terms

Etymology

edit

From Arabic اِشْتَغَلَ (ištaḡala).

Pronunciation

edit
  • IPA(key): /iʃ.ta.ɣal/, [ɪʃˈta.ɣal]
  • Audio (al-Lidd):(file)

Verb

edit

اشتغل (ištaḡal) VIII (present بشتغل (bištḡel))

  1. to work (+ على)
    ما اشتغلت مبارح.
    ištaḡalt mbāreḥ
    I didn't work yesterday.
    شو بتشتغل؟
    šū btištḡel?
    What do you do for a living?
    (literally, “what do you work?”)
    لازم نبدا نشتغل عالمشروع الإنجليزي.
    lāzem nibda ništḡel ʕal-mašrūʕ il-ʔinglīzi
    We have to start working on the English project.
